The sixth edition of the Dog Carnival in Lagos, Nigeria, themed “Angels on Legs,” celebrated the unique bond between humans and their canine companions. This vibrant event, held in the bustling heart of Lagos, brought together dog lovers from all walks of life, transforming the city into a kaleidoscope of wagging tails, playful barks, and heartwarming displays of affection. The carnival served as a platform to showcase the diverse world of dogs, from pedigree breeds with their impeccable lineage to endearing mixed breeds with their unique charm. Beyond the festive atmosphere, the event also served a crucial purpose: promoting responsible dog ownership and raising awareness about the importance of animal welfare in a society where such considerations often take a backseat. The carnival highlighted the vital role dogs play in our lives, not only as beloved pets but also as service animals, therapy companions, and guardians of our homes.

The carnival grounds buzzed with a diverse range of activities designed to entertain both humans and their furry friends. Dog owners had the opportunity to participate in various competitions, showcasing their dogs’ talents and training. Agility courses tested the dogs’ physical prowess and obedience, while costume contests allowed owners to express their creativity and celebrate their dogs’ unique personalities. The vibrant costumes, ranging from superhero capes to whimsical fairy wings, added a touch of playful charm to the already festive atmosphere. Beyond the competitions, the carnival offered a plethora of other attractions, including dog grooming stations, pet adoption booths, and informational stands providing valuable insights into dog care, nutrition, and health.

Beyond the entertainment and festivities, the Dog Carnival served as a powerful platform for promoting responsible dog ownership. Informational booths disseminated valuable resources on dog care, emphasizing the importance of proper nutrition, regular veterinary checkups, and responsible breeding practices. Representatives from animal welfare organizations were present to educate attendees about the importance of spaying and neutering, responsible pet adoption, and the fight against animal cruelty. The carnival highlighted the significant impact responsible dog ownership has on both individual dogs and the wider community, emphasizing the need for ethical treatment and compassionate care.
